What's it like to stay in a motel?
Motels often offer free parking, and many have outdoor pools. Often one or two stories tall, motels usually have outdoor access to guestrooms from the parking lot. Introduced in the early 1950s, customized neon signs often lit up the roadside motels, and examples today can still be seen along historic U.S. Route 66.

What can I do in Swansea?
Check out the bustling marina and enjoy the lively bars in this quaint area while you're sightseeing. People visiting Swansea have good things to say about the festivals. These are some of the parks and outdoorsy places: Swansea Beach, Singleton Park, and Swansea Bay. You'll find these family-friendly attractions: Clyne Gardens, National Showcaves Centre for Wales, and Plantasia. Some historical places you might want to see include Mumbles Lighthouse, Penllergare Valley Woods, and Oxwich Castle.
What's the seasonal weather like in Swansea?
Weather can make or break a roadtrip, so we've gathered some data about year-round temperatures in Swansea to help you plan yours.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 60°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 44°F. Average annual precipitation for Swansea is 54 inches.
What are my options for getting around Swansea when staying in a motel?
We've gathered some information about getting around Swansea to help you navigate your stay: Fly into Cardiff International Airport (CWL), which is located 30.2 mi (48.6 km) away from the city center. If you want to see more of the area, ride aboard a train from Swansea Station, Swansea (WSS-Swansea Train Station), or Llansamlet Station. You can find out about your water travel options at the marina.
